The Automobile Lease document is a legal agreement between a Lessor and a Lessee for the rental of a vehicle in Maryland. This comprehensive lease articulates the terms of use, responsibilities, and liabilities that govern the relationship between the parties over the lease term. Key features include stipulations on payment amounts, maintenance responsibilities, and insurance requirements that the Lessee must fulfill. Notably, the form emphasizes the Lessee's obligation to keep the automobile in good running condition and the procedures for addressing necessary repairs. Mechanical stimulation of the mastoid and diverting attention to pleasant stimuli-like odors or music have been found to ameliorate VIMS. Chewing gum combines both in an easy-to-administer fashion and should thus be an effective countermeasure against VIMS.

Although it is generally agreed that having control over a moving vehicle greatly reduces the likelihood of motion sickness, few studies have addressed this issue directly, and the theoretical explanation for this phenomenon is not completely clear.

In general, motion sickness doesn't cause serious health issues. In some cases, however, people continue to feel nauseous and even though they're not doing things like riding in vehicles. Excessive vomiting can cause dehydration and low blood pressure (hypotension).

Check if you have motion sickness dizziness. feeling sick (nausea) being sick. headache. feeling cold and going pale. sweating.

How to ease motion sickness yourself reduce motion – sit in the front of a car or in the middle of a boat. look straight ahead at a fixed point, such as the horizon. breathe fresh air if possible – for example, by opening a car window. close your eyes and breathe slowly while focusing on your breathing.

A pharmacist can help with motion sickness You can buy remedies from pharmacies to prevent motion sickness, including: tablets – dissolvable tablets are available for children. patches – can be used by adults and children over 10. acupressure bands – these do not work for everyone.

If possible, try lying down, shutting your eyes, sleeping, or looking at the horizon. Stay hydrated by drinking water. Limit alcoholic and caffeinated beverages. Eat small amounts of food frequently.

Ginger. Having some ginger on hand is a great way to beat nausea. In fact, it's been successfully used as a nausea remedy for centuries. Whether you do it raw, crystallised or brewed in a tea, this solution is super simple and convenient when you're feeling queasy on a boat.
